Quick Summary
The Defense Health Agency (DHA), through Naval Medical Center Portsmouth, has issued a Request for Information (RFI) for a Cost Per Results Reportable (CPRR) Automated Hematology Analyzer. This RFI aims to identify potential sources and assess the commercial nature of required supplies for a new contract, as the current one expires in August 2026. Responses are due March 25, 2026.
Purpose
This RFI is for market research and planning purposes only and does not constitute a solicitation or a guarantee of a future contract. The Government will not consider unsolicited proposals or offers. Its primary goal is to gather information on industry capabilities and determine if the required supplies are commercial, in accordance with FAR Part 10.
Scope of Work
The requirement is for a CPRR Automated Hematology Analyzer system at Naval Medical Center Portsmouth, VA. Key capabilities include:
- High-throughput analysis: Reliable and extensive, capable of ≥ 200 tests per hour.
- Technology: Utilizes fluorescent flow cytometry to analyze RNA and DNA content and intracellular cellular structures.
- Quality Control: Integrated automated QC module capable of performing, evaluating, and documenting quality control without user intervention, with traceability.
- Integration: Capable of connecting with middleware and command center components for integrated total lab automation. A DRAFT Statement of Work (SOW) is available for review.

Submission Instructions
Responses must be submitted electronically in Microsoft Word or Adobe PDF format. Submissions should include:
- Cover Page (1 page): Title, Organization, Responder's technical and administrative points of contact (names, addresses, phone, email), and CAGE Code.
- Capabilities Statement: Address understanding of the DRAFT SOW, experience with similar work, existing contract vehicles (e.g., GSA schedule), and whether services are provided to the general public under similar terms. Do not request a copy of the solicitation as none exists.
